Donald Trump's $10 billion defamation lawsuit against the BBC over an edit of a speech he made on 6 Jan 2021 has raised legal and ethical questions, and has brought a focus on the potentially chilling effects on freedom of speech.Considering the issues in this Global Insight podcast are: Nick Pollard, former Head of Sky News; former Chairman, UK Office of Communications (Ofcom) Content Committee Gill Phillips, former Director of Legal Services, The Guardian; member, Centre for Investigative Journalism Board of Trustees Mark Stephens, media and defamation lawyer, Howard Kennedy; Co-Chair, IBA's Human Rights Institute Alan Rusbridger, former Editor, The Guardian
